Kidney Disease: Can Lamotrigine, (also known as Lamictol) cause renal failure or chronic kidney disease over time?

I'm a student pharmacist and according to the most recent Drug Information Handbook, Lamotrigine can possibly cause acute renal failure in less than one percent of people taking the drug. And the drug summary information from micromedex mentions the possible renal impairment.
